If you’re a solo business owner with no employees and you prefer the Roth retirement account, there’s a powerful strategy you should know about: the Mega Backdoor Roth.
You’ve probably heard of the backdoor Roth IRA—great for high earners, but it maxes out at just $7,000 per year (or $8,000 if you’re 50+).
Now imagine being able to contribute up to $70,000 (or $77,500 if you’re 50+) into a Roth account this year.
That’s the kind of tenfold upgrade we’re talking about.
